Some schools and academic departments within AACC have dedicated staff specifically to support the internship process. You are encouraged to contact staff directly within those specialized areas of study for details about how internships are integrated into the curricula. Also, all students are welcome to register for and seek internships on the campus-wide Internship Navigator, an online database to facilitate students and mentors seeking each other.
